I do have several loggers, including the .packets :)

But no matter which logger i have tried using, I can only get the leases if I put it in DEBUG. And my concern with .leases, is that it seems “weird” that you get no entries when you log with INFO. Maybe it’s because i have a believe that no production systems should be in any kind of debug mode - although I’m aware that the system itself is not actual in debug mode but just logging debug messages. And I would also believe that almost everyone would be interested in the lease log per default in order to identify the mac address associated to an IP address.

The logger named kea-dhcp4 doesn’t log much when in INFO level. Mainly only startup info like subnet config and lease file load.
